Tommy, the little boy, had three funny friends. There was Billy, who always wore a big red hat. There was Sally, who laughed like a ticklish puppy. And there was Jamie, who loved to dance and twirl!

One sunny day, they decided to play a game. “Let's build a rocket!” said Tommy. “Zoom, zoom!” everyone cheered. But they didn't have a rocket.

“Hmm,” said Billy, scratching his head. “What do we have?”

“I have a box!” said Sally, jumping up and down.

“I have some stickers!” said Jamie, wiggling happily.

“Let's use the box!” Tommy shouted. So, they took the box and put it on the grass.

Billy put on his big red hat. “This is the rocket's cap!”

Sally stuck a shiny sticker on the box. “This is the sparkly window!”

Jamie twirled around. “And it needs a dance!”

They all danced around the box, laughing. “Zoom, zoom!” they shouted together.

Suddenly, a butterfly flew by. “Ooh!” said Sally. “Let's follow it!”

Off they went, running and giggling. They forgot the box!

“Oh no!” Tommy cried.

“Don't worry!” said Jamie. “We can find it!”

They looked and looked. “There it is!” shouted Billy.

It was still there, waiting. They all cheered.

“Now our rocket is ready!” said Tommy.

They climbed in the box, and lifted off together.

“Zoom, zoom!” they laughed.

What a fun adventure! Friends, laughter, and a box made the best rocket ever!
